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8694 8432875 411 447322 4836961
74 74
74 74
3091 65 37974
All about undefined
Interested in learning more?
74 74
3091 65 37974
See more
0806659 09610373900
9656 849790 1503078 237010069
See more
2260943570 9047063883 4657379
876331189 316915636 12777 761865 31762
See more